Photo by fish socks on Pexels Northern Territory Charity Gaming Laws The NT Gaming Control Act 1993 governs prize home draws. Charities must hold community gaming licences. These cost $100 each year plus fees. NT laws differ from eastern states. Charities can run unlimited draws per year. Each draw needs separate approval. Ticket prices are $20 maximum per entry. Prize values face no legal limits. However, NT Consumer Affairs watches draws. They make sure prizes match advertised values. Independent valuations are required. Legal Insight: NT charity gaming laws are less strict than NSW or Victoria. This lets smaller charities run prize home draws with lower costs. Alice Springs Property Market Context Alice Springs median house prices reached $485,000 in 2024. This shows 8% growth from 2023. Unit prices average $320,000. The rental market stays tight. Vacancy rates sit at 1.2%. Rental yields average 6.8% for houses. Units yield 7.4%. Prize homes appear in established suburbs. Gillen, Sadadeen, and Stuart Park are popular choices. These areas offer closeness to town centres and schools. Building costs in Alice Springs beat capital cities. Remote location adds 15-20% to building costs. This affects prize home values
